How to subtract 4/5 by 9?

4 5 9 1 = (4 × 1) − (9 × 5) 5 × 1 = -41 5
  1. Multiply the numerator of the first term, with the denominator of the second term: 4 × 1 = 4
  2. Multiply the numerator of the second term, with the denominator of the first term: 9 × 5 = 45
  3. Subtract both of these results together to form the new numerator: 4 − 45 = -41
  4. Multiply both denominators together to form the new denominator: 5 × 1 = 5
  5. Combine the results to get the new fraction: -41/5

The result of subtracting 4/5 and 9/1 is : -41/5 (or -8.2 in its decimal form)
